Pulse Performance Recalls Children's Electric Scooters Due to Fall Hazard; Sold Exclusively at Target
Pulse Performance Products, a division of Bravo Sports of Santa Fe Springs, Calif.

Consumers should immediately take the recalled scooters away from children and contact Pulse Performance Products for a full refund.
Firm contact: Pulse Performance Products toll-free at 844-287-8711 from 7:30 a.m. to 4 p.m. PT Monday through Friday or online at www.pulsescooters.com and click on "CPSC Safety Recalls" for more information.

- Children's electric scooters
- Amount recalled
- About 8,900
Where it was sold
Sold at Target stores nationwide from October 2016 through November 2016 for about $100..
Why it was recalled
The knuckle that joins the wheel to the axle can break, posing a fall hazard to the rider.
